Let r, v and E are the radius of the orbit, speed of the electron and the total energy of the electron respectively. Which of the following quantities are proportional to the quantum number .n. ?

Answer»

`rE`
`ur`
`upsilon/E`
`R/E`

Solution :`upsilon = (2.188xx10^(-8))/(n)` CM/sec
`r= n^2 XX 0.529 xx 10^(-8) cm , E=-(2.18 xx 10^(-18))/(n^2)`
these relations shown that `upsilonr and (upsilon)/(E)` will be proportional to be principal quantum number n.
